    The aim of this paper is to generalize the theory of pseudo-valuation domains (PVD) to commutative rings with identity. The authors define a pseudo-valuation ring (PVR) as a ring where each prime ideal \(P\) is strongly prime, i.e. a prime ideal such that whenever \(a,b \in R\) then \(aP\) and \(bP\) are comparable. They extend known results on PVD, study the stability of the class of PVRs under passage to overrings and decide when the integral closure of a PVR \((R,M)\) equals \((M:M)\).NEWLINENEWLINEFor the entire collection see [Zbl 0855.00015].
